Minnesota state park summer tours now taking reservations
This summer, Minnesota state parks will offer tours that highlight life in a prairie (including the possibility of viewing bison!), the longest cave in the state and Minnesota’s mining history. Tours take place at Blue Mounds, Forestville/ Mystery Cave, and Lake Vermilion-Soudan Underground Mine state parks.
DNR takes important step toward building a modernized electronic license system
The Minnesota Department of Natural Resources and Minnesota IT Services have selected conservation technology company S3 as the vendor to build a modern electronic licensing system to serve the state’s anglers, boaters, hunters and recreational vehicle owners.

Commissioners continue to look into bank property for new Human Services location
Commissioners continue to look into bank property for new Human Services location At Tuesday morning’s meeting of the Chippewa County Commissioners, a representative from Klein McCarthy Architects was on hand to give a presentation on the Family Services Facility Plan. The County Commissioners have been investigating the idea of purchasing the former Minnwest Bank building downtown to house Family Services, and potentially Prairie Five due to the state of the current location, and the cost of maintaining that location.
